Salisbury (charged by vehicles)

“As you will see, we had strong growth up to the start of the recession. From March 2008 to May 2009 the numbers were showing a decline. Since May, passenger figures seem to have stabilised (no further decline) but they have not recovered to the pre-recession levels. This is inspite of the rise in concessionary fare usage.”

As can be seen above, there has been a 4.75% reduction in the number of passengers compared to the same period in 2007/08.  There was a slight increase in passenger numbers in 2007/08 compared to the same period in 2006/07.  There was a smaller reduction in passenger numbers from June 2009 compared to the preceding months.
